A private assessment for adhd is usually conducted by an expert psychiatrist, psychologist, or a specialist nurse. Only healthcare professionals from the UK are competent to diagnose ADHD. They will ask questions about your current symptoms and make note of your previous experiences. They will also take into consideration your family history as well as any other mental health issues you might have. It is essential to be honest about your health issues, as they could affect the way in which the diagnosis is determined.

The healthcare professional will also evaluate your symptoms in accordance with the DSM V criteria. The assessment will include questions about inattention and hyperactivity. It is important to prepare for the test by studying the symptoms of ADHD, so you can know the questions you'll be asked about. You should also write down some of the symptoms you experience so that you can be prepared for the questions you will be asked by your doctor.

The healthcare professional will discuss the results with you following the test. They'll either confirm or deny your diagnosis of ADHD or provide reasons why they don't believe you meet the criteria for this condition. They might also suggest another diagnosis would better explain your symptoms.

If you've been diagnosed with ADHD, your psychiatrist will devise a personalized treatment plan that will include medication and therapy. This can be conducted in person via phone or via video conference call. In the case of medication the psychiatrist will go over your treatment options and prescribe the right dosage for you. The medications for ADHD can cause side effects, so you should speak with your doctor about the risks and benefits of each drug. For example, methylphenidate can cause sleepiness and elevated blood pressure. These drugs can also result in dependence, so it's essential to be aware of their use. If you are concerned about the side effects of methylphenidate, ask your doctor to prescribe lower doses or switch to a different drug.

Neuropsychologists

If you're in search of an ADHD assessment, it is best to find a GMC-registered consultant psychiatrist with experience treating both adults and children with ADHD. You should also consider a clinic that offers neuropsychological tests for ADHD as well as autism, learning disabilities, and non-verbal disorders. This kind of test is a comprehensive set of tasks that determines how your brain works. These tests can only be conducted by neuropsychologists who are clinical psychologists. They can provide you with the most precise diagnosis and assist you in understanding the effects of ADHD on your child at home, school, and their relationships with others.

In the majority of cases, the first visit with a neuropsychologist will begin with an initial consultation to gather information regarding your child's current performance. During this interview, the examiner will ask questions about your child's growth from birth to early life and medical history. This information will allow the examiner to select the best tests for your child.

A comprehensive ADHD assessment could consist of one or more of the standardized scales for rating behavior. These scales are based on research comparing the behavior of people suffering from ADHD and people who do not suffer from ADHD. The clinician may also use these questionnaires to determine the presence of any co-existing disorders such as anxiety or depression.

Following the neuropsychological test you will be scheduled for a follow-up meeting to discuss your findings. The session will be conducted on a separate day from the testing, and typically lasts for about half a day. This is an important stage in the process and you'll need to be sure to take your time and take note of the results.

You will receive a written evaluation report after this session that you can give to your family physician. The report will outline the results of the assessment and will offer recommendations for your child's treatment. In the majority of cases, the recommended treatments will involve a combination of medication and behavioral therapy.

Counsellors

It is essential to speak with an expert if you suspect that you suffer from ADHD. This will help you comprehend your symptoms and help you find the appropriate treatment. Typically an ADHD assessment will involve an appointment with a psychiatrist or Neuropsychologist. It will also include an interview with a clinician, an online test and several other tests. In most cases, a comprehensive cognitive test will be included in your assessment, which will allow the doctor to evaluate your memory, intelligence, attention as well as executive functioning and language.

If it is not treated, ADHD can cause a range of problems in your personal and professional life. These can include anxiety and depression, as well as problems with your relationships and work. The good news is that ADHD is treatable and can be managed effectively with medication and therapy. If you don't get an accurate diagnosis, you might not receive the treatment you require.

It isn't easy to identify ADHD, especially when you are an adult. This is because people with ADHD have a variety of symptoms, including hyperactivity and the tendency to be impulsive. They are also likely to be easily distracted and have difficulty in focusing on their tasks. While these characteristics are common in children however, they tend to be less prominent in adults.
